After *hours* of carb fettling that, in hindsight, couldn't possibly have been the actual required-fix, Roni finds a clear and definite problem - two out of those five wires are broken! One is one of the phases from the alternator (hence no battery charging) and the other is the low-tension for the coil (hence barely-running) - PA102623
Couple of crimps (well, three crimps and a chocolate-block in the end)... - PA102624.JPG
- PA102627
... and it's all fixed! - PA102630.JPG
